    Margery Kempe: The Life of a Medieval Mystic

    Anthony Bale's book, Margery Kempe, is a vivid exploration of the life of one of the most fascinating figures of medieval England. Margery, a notable Christian mystic and pilgrim, is known for her Book of Margery Kempe, the oldest surviving autobiography in English. Bale begins by introducing us to Margery, a married woman-turned-religious devotee, who experienced visions of Jesus Christ, eliciting both awe and controversy in the society of her time.

    Her mystical experiences led her to challenge societal norms, choosing chastity despite her married status and dedicating her life to spiritual pursuit. The book takes us through her journey across England, Italy, Spain, and Jerusalem, marking key episodes of her holy visions and the trials faced as an outspoken woman in the 15th century.

    A Candid Exploration of Faith and Society

    In the middle part of Margery Kempe, Bale delves deeper into Margery's internal struggles and public confrontations. We follow Margery's life as she strikes a deal of celibacy with her husband, has distinctive Christian experiences, weeps and cries excessively in public spaces, and even faces charges of heresy. Her radical spirituality and peculiar conduct urged her peers to question her devotion, accusing her of seeking attention.

    Margery's book, a detailed account of her divine encounters, becomes the primary tool through which she attempts to legitimize her experiences. Here, Bale presents a relevant commentary on the societal and religious norms of Margery's time, challenging the silent roles expected of women and the limited spiritual avenues accessible to them.

    Legacy of a Medieval Christian Mystic

    As the narrative of Margery Kempe progresses towards the end, Bale discusses how Margery, upon returning from her pilgrimage, writes her book. Difficulties faced in her quest to find a suitable scribe further fortify her resolve.

    In conclusion, Margery Kempe is a captivating blend of a historical record and an in-depth character study. Through Margery's life, it offers an insight into the gender dynamics, societal norms, and religious practices of the 15th century. It tells the tale of a persevering woman, a devout Christian, unyielding in her pursuit of spiritual fulfillment. Despite the countless hardships and societal disdain, Margery's legacy persists, marking her as a significant figure in medieval Christian mysticism.
